skimming 2. How many theme parks are mentioned in the passage ? And what are they ? Read the text and find out the answers to the questions 1. Whats a theme park ? A theme park is a collection of rides, exhibitions or other attractions that are based on a common theme. Five. They are the World Park, China Ethnic Culture Park, Ocean Park in Hong Kong, Disneyland in California and Universal Studios in Florida.

skimming 3. What do the parks have in common ? 4. Whats the difference between a theme park and a traditional amusement park ? Read the text and find out the answers to the questions What they all have in common is that they combine fun with the opportunity to learn something. Unlike traditional amusement parks, theme parks often want to teach visitors something.
